On the website, select the signals menu, choose MT4 or MT5, then click the filter on the right hand side of the page. Go to the last option (Subscription Fee) and drag the slider to price equals 0 to 0. That will get you free (demo) signals

In metatrader, you will see either free (demo) or paid (real) signals depending on the broker account you are logged into (eg logged in to a demo account you will see demo signals)
